Raised Panels Raised panels add an extra level of detail to doors for cabinets that elevate the look beyond the typical flat-surfaced doors used in builders grade. When paired with arched or cathedral frames, they can provide a more classic look. They are available in different styles that can add texture and dimension to your woodwork project. A router bit with an angled profile that allows you to elevate the wood stock above other materials is required to create a raised panel. There are many different profiles to choose from and each comes with a set instructions which explain how to set up the router for each profile. These instructions are specific to the type of wood species and type of router that you're using. Once you've set up your router with the proper bit you can begin raising the stock in order to create an opening in the middle of your door. The panel cutting requires a lot of patience and expertise, but the end product will be a stunning door that will last for years. It is important to not attach the panel to the frame while finishing raised panel doors. The frame needs to be able to move and expand in response to seasonal variations in temperature and humidity. The frame might crack or break when the panel is glued to it. Instead of gluing the panel in place, it is best to utilize space balls on each side of the frame. These tiny foam balls will help the panel to float in the frame. They are simple to use, and are affordable. A raised panel cabinet door gives a the classic and timeless look to your cabinets. They are easy to work with and can be finished to fit any style. They are also more durable and less susceptible to warping than regular doors. Doors that slide Doors As opposed to hinged doors with hinges, sliding doors open and close horizontally along tracks. They are typically used as hotel and store entrances, as well as in elevators and even in transport vehicles, like buses and trains. They are also common in homes for residential use, being used as doors for patios and as room dividers. Sliding doors come in a variety of configurations, but they all have two things that they share: their movability and glass panes. The movability of the door allows better airflow and control over light, while the glass provides an uninterrupted view of the outside environment. The standard panel sliding door is the simplest type. It is made up of a single or multiple doors that are encased within a frame. They are then fitted with a handle and lock like hinged doors. These are commonly found in a range of interior applications and are available from a variety of retailers, as well as being custom-built. Another alternative is a pocket door, which does not require the space of a track and instead opens into a slot that's recessed into a wall. These doors are popular in closets and come in various designs and colors. Barn doors are a different alternative. They are hung on tracks that are attached to the doorway or closet. The Stacker door is an alternative. They consist of a number of smaller doors placed on tracks that are smaller and can be stacked after opening. These kinds of doors are easy to maintain and they provide excellent security. They can make rooms appear larger by allowing more sunlight to pass through and by reducing artificial lighting. Sliding doors are also simple to use and quieter to close and open than hinged doors. Internal Fire Doors Fire doors are a vital part of home security, because they can help limit the spread spread of fire and smoke. They offer more time for residents to escape and allow emergency services to contain the flames in their early stages, leading to a safer and healthier environment for everyone. Residential interior fire doors are usually made of wood or metal, with a solid core and timber studs made of gypsum or. They can be equipped with a variety of fire-rated equipment, such as handles and hinges. They are labelled in accordance with their FD rating, which reveals how long they can hold back fire and smoke. The doors are available in many colours and finishes to suit your home. There are several different types of fire doors that are available, with the most popular ones being FD30 and FD60. These ratings indicate how long the door can endure exposure to fire as determined by an in-depth fire test that assesses its ability to withstand flames and heat without collapsing or failing. Intumescent strips are typically used to fill the gap between a door and its frame in the event of a fire. This prevents toxic smoke from spreading. While you can purchase fire safety doors for your home from a variety of locations, it's recommended to choose an certified company to ensure that the installation is compliant with all applicable guidelines and safety protocols. The smallest gaps, the use of automatic closers, or alterations that affect the performance of the door can have a significant impact on its effectiveness. It could also render it unfit. Unlike internal doors generally, fire doors are heavier and much more substantial, as they need to be able to stand up to the force of a fire and the heat generated by it.
